This security bulletin contains information about 2 secuirty vulnerabilities.
1) NULL pointer dereference (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-38089)
The vulnerability allows a local user to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to NULL pointer dereference within the svc_process_common() function in net/sunrpc/svc.c. A local user can per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
2)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-38477)
The vulnerability allows a local user to escalate privileges on the system.
The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error within the qfq_change_class(), qfq_delete_class(), qfq_dump_class() and qfq_dump_class_stats() functions in net/sched/sch_qfq.c. A local user can escalate privileges on the system.
